For AMBONES: A Spooktober Level-18 Raise!
To give context, AMBONES, a Seattle-based top DDR player, is issuing players the “Spooktober” challenge to, in every session, raise at least one level-18 chart. Since I’ve been so heavy into timing development over the past year, I’ve thus not prioritized stamina development, so my upper-level ability has suffered as a result.
Taking this challenge up has thus been an opportunity to, at least in passing, make incremental gains regaining the ability to play upper-level charts with an increased pass rate and of course increased scores.
Today, I raised Triple Journey CSP by about 20k points to just under 870k. Passing it was a blessing - I was off to a great start comboing almost the entire first half; but by the end, my legs were giving out and beginning to get stuck on the pad, and I was losing life bar fast as a consequence. I had to bracket-mash the ending stream just to pass it, but it felt really rewarding to see a blue pacemaker throughout the song.
This is one less chart to think about as I advance toward an 850k score floor on the 18’s (For the Amethyst 3 requirement, 20 remain before 7 exceptions; I’ve yet to clear the A3 18’s).
